Ship and Anchor owner worried proposed development could ‘contribute to our demise’

https://livewirecalgary.com/2026/01/...oogle_vignette

Quote:
The owner of the iconic Ship and Anchor Pub on 17 Avenue SW fears a proposed development could mean the demise of their Beltline establishment.

“It is unrealistic to think that the music can be muted to the point that it will be acceptable to someone trying to sleep in the apartments. It will almost certainly lead to complaints, which bylaw officers will have to respond to and we will have to address,” he said.

“If, however, this project is approved as currently presented, then putting on live shows as we have for 35 years, free to our customers as they’ve always been, at the same volume as they’ve always been presented, could, in fact, contribute to our demise.”

There was also concern expressed over potential conflict between residents in the new units and Ship customers.

“We don’t think Ship customers are going to be nearly as comfortable in that setting, and that would compromise what has become a very popular spot for the Beltline community further,” Ballantyne said.

“If we were in a situation that some of the residents overlooking the patio are also bothered by the music or crowds on the patio, it might not just be awkward. It is conceivable that it could become openly hostile.”
